Troubleshooting

Error Codes

Problem

Cause

Action

Unit will not turn on 

(no power)

Yellow wire not connected or incorrect voltage 

Red wire not connected or incorrect voltage

Check connections for proper voltage 

(11~16VDC) 

Black wire not connected

Check connection to ground

Fuse blown

Replace fuse

Unit has power 

(but no sound)

Speaker wires not connected

Check connections at speakers

One or more speaker wires touching each 

other or touching chassis ground

Insulate all bare speaker wires from each 

other and chassis ground

Unit blows fuses

Yellow or red wire touching chassis ground

Check for pinched wire

Speaker wires touching chassis ground

Check for pinched wire

Incorrect fuse rating

Use fuse with correct rating

Excessive skipping

Unit is not mounted correctly

Check mounting sleeve or add a  backstrap 

support 

Physical defect in media (CD, CD-R or CD-RW)

Check media for scratches

Unit will not accept

a disc

CD mechanism position out of alignment

Press EJECT for 3 seconds to reset

CD mechanism position

CD transit screws still in place

 Remove 2 transit screws located on top of 

the unit.

Error Code

Cause

Action

ER-1 appears on the display

Disc error

Press eject or RESET

ER-2 appears on the display

Mechanism error or disc is upside down

Press eject or RESET

ER-3 appears on the display

Servo Error

Press eject or RESET
